![]() | 137 Sqn late 1941 early 1942 Can anyone help me with a date and an identity, at some time between 30 November 1941 and 12 February 1942, the CO of 137 Sqn Ldr Hugh Coghlan arranged for one of his flight commanders to be transferred away from the Squadron, he in fact threatened to have him sent east, though I am not sure if this actually happened, in any case the officer was sent on 10 days leave, before being posted. I am assuming that this was the Flight Commander of "B" flight, as Robert Woodward was "A" flight commander. Can anyone confirm this chaps identity. This information has come from the transcript of some of Woodward’s letters to his wife at the time.
